## Onboarding — Markdown Pipeline (Inkmere)

Inkmere docs render through a three-stage pipeline: parse, sanitize, emit. Releases rebuild all templates; never hot-patch emitted HTML. Broken renders usually mean a sanitizer rule change — check the rules diff first. The render cluster only accepts builds from the release channel, and every build artifact must be signed before upload. Sign artifacts with the deploy key below.

release key, hafop-tajef: bky13_s2vaFVNJTHfBL

- [ ] Step 7: Archive cold storage buckets (Glacierline tier). Confirm both ceremony witnesses are present, verify bucket manifests match the Oxbow ledger, then seal the archive key shares. Plugin authors may observe but not handle shares. Once sealed, the archive index itself is encrypted and can only be reopened with the passphrase below.

vault phrase of badup-hahig = tamael-aldael-kelmir-istael-fenok-istwyn-tamius-jorath-oliion

// REINDEX_BATCH_CAP limits docs per shard pass in the Tallowfield
// nightly search reindex. Raising it starves the ingest queue;
// lowering it overruns the maintenance window. 5000 is the tested
// sweet spot. Change only with a soak run. Verified against the
// build noted below.

session token of bawif-hahog = htk6_ac5981

Welcome aboard. The Sievecraft platform loads third-party data validators as plugins, and each environment should run an identical plugin manifest. We've confirmed the staging host in the Arlen cluster is loading two schema validators at versions newer than production, which explains the mismatched rejection rates reported last sprint. Before you patch anything, snapshot both hosts and diff the manifests — drift has historically crept in through manual installs. Staging currently starts its plugin host with the following configuration.

service settings:
WENATH_PIN=5007
WENATH_METRICS_HOST=metrics.wenath.tolvaqlabs.corp
WENATH_LOG_LEVEL=debug
WENATH_TENANT=rusox